A robust and user-friendly Java-based desktop application for managing all essential market operations — including cashier tasks, warehouse control, and employee management.
The Market Management System is a comprehensive software solution for streamlining daily operations within a market or retail environment. This application is built using Java and Swing GUI, with an SQLite database for efficient local data storage. It is designed for Windows desktop platforms and focuses on usability, speed, and operational coverage.
-
🧾 Cashier Management
Sales transactions, invoice generation, and secure payment processing. -
📦 Warehouse Management
Stock tracking, product registration, quantity adjustments, and inventory reports. -
👨💼 Employee Affairs
Store employee details, manage work hours, and compute incentives. -
🖥️ User Interface
Simple and clean GUI built with Java Swing for fast navigation. -
💾 Database
Uses SQLite for lightweight, embedded, and fast data handling.
| Layer | Technology |
|---|---|
| Language | Java |
| GUI | Swing / AWT |
| Database | SQLite |
| OS | Windows Desktop |
| Packaging | Executable .exe |
You can download and run the precompiled executable for Windows here:
⚠️ Make sure to have Java Runtime Environment (JRE) installed to run the.exefile.
Hedra Nabil
📧 hedranabil614@gmail.com
📍 Egypt
💼 Java Desktop Developer | Available for Freelance Projects
This project is licensed under the MIT License. See the LICENSE file for details.
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)
.png)